OK, I've got a series of navigation manager pages that need to be
converted to pages where the navigation is emulated or copied from the
parent page. Leaf pages if you will.

The leaf template I'm using works just fine. I can create a leaf page
and it doesn't show in the left nav and it mirrors the parent's
navigation perfectly. The problem is when I convert from a nav page to
this leaf page using a Replace Content Class command.

All I am doing is selecting the page, choosing "replace content
class", checking to see if everything lines up and clicking ok. Once
that is done, the page is properly converted, but the navigation
leaves a big gap where the link used to be. If I check the Navigation
Manager, the page has clearly been removed from the parent's index. I
have cleared both the navigation cache and page cache. Neither
resolved this issue.

So, what's going on here?
